Why Financial Copywriting Matters in South Africa

Financial services are built on trust, clarity and compliance. Poorly written copy can confuse potential clients, open firms to compliance risk, and waste marketing spend. Strong, targeted financial copy achieves several goals:

  • Builds credibility with clear, accurate messaging that respects FSCA and POPIA considerations.
  • Educates prospects—turning complex terms like “annuity”, “unit trust” or “tax efficient wrapper” into actionable benefits.
  • Boosts conversion rates on websites, landing pages and email campaigns—improving ROI on ad spend.
  • Improves organic visibility when combined with financial SEO strategies tailored for South African search trends.
